DescriptionSash made from white silk grosgrain with relatively light ribbing. The sash is composed of a large bow, from which emanate (1) two wide pieces of silk that taper to a point at their ends and are intended to belt around the waist, and (2) a thin piece of silk intended as a streamer to be worn at the back with the bow.
